工具。其特点是通过嵌套的矩形区域来表示层次结构,每个矩形区域的大小表示该层次的数据量。树图适合用于展示层次结构数据的组成部分和整体关系,直观地反映各部分的占比。
例如,公司希望展示各部门的销售数据,可以采用树图,将公司整体销售额表示为一个大矩形,各部门的销售额表示为嵌套在大矩形内的小矩形。通过观察树图,可以直观地看到各部门在整体销售额中的占比,识别出主要贡献部门和次要贡献部门。
树图的另一个常见用途是展示分类数据。例如,公司希望分析产品类别的销售情况,可以采用树图,将总销售额表示为一个大矩形,各产品类别的销售额表示为嵌套在大矩形内的小矩形。通过观察树图,可以直观地看到各产品类别在总销售额中的占比,识别出畅销类别和滞销类别。
FineBI、FineReport和FineVis均支持创建树图,并提供丰富的定制选项,用户可以根据需要调整矩形区域的颜色、边框和显示格式,以更好地展示层次结构数据。
八、桑基图
桑基图是一种用于展示能量、物质或资金流动的数据可视化工具。其特点是通过流动路径的宽度表示流量的大小,直观地展示流动过程和流量分布。桑基图适合用于展示复杂系统中的流动关系,帮助用户理解流动过程中的关键环节。
例如,公司希望展示资金流动情况,可以采用桑基图,将资金流动的各环节表示为节点,资金流动的路径表示为连接各节点的流动路径,通过流动路径的宽度表示资金流量的大小。通过观察桑基图,可以直观地看到资金流动的关键环节和主要流向,识别出资金流动的瓶颈和优化机会。
桑基图的另一个常见用途是展示能量流动。例如,公司希望分析能源使用情况,可以采用桑基图,将能源的生产、转换和使用环节表示为节点,能源流动的路径表示为连接各节点的流动路径,通过流动路径的宽度表示能量流量的大小。通过观察桑基图,可以直观地看到能量流动的各环节和主要流向,识别出能量浪费和节能机会。
FineBI、FineReport和FineVis均支持创建桑基图,并提供丰富的定制选项,用户可以根据需要调整节点和流动路径的颜色、样式和显示格式,以更好地展示流动数据。
九、瀑布图
瀑布图是一种用于展示数据增减变化过程的数据可视化工具。其特点是通过颜色区分增量和减量,通过柱子的高度表示数据变化的大小,直观地展示数据的累计变化过程。瀑布图适合用于展示数据的逐步变化,帮助用户理解数据变化的细节。
例如,公司希望展示利润的构成情况,可以采用瀑布图,将收入、成本、税费等构成因素表示为柱子,通过颜色区分各因素的增量和减量,最后一根柱子表示累计利润。通过观察瀑布图,可以直观地看到各构成因素对利润的贡献,识别出主要的增值和减值因素。
瀑布图的另一个常见用途是展示项目进度。例如,公司希望展示项目各阶段的进展情况,可以采用瀑布图,将各阶段的进展表示为柱子,通过颜色区分各阶段的完成量和未完成量,最后一根柱子表示项目的总进度。通过观察瀑布图,可以直观地看到各阶段的完成情况,识别出进展较慢的阶段和需要加快进度的环节。
FineBI、FineReport和FineVis均支持创建瀑布图,并提供丰富的定制选项,用户可以根据需要调整柱子的颜色、样式和显示格式,以更好地展示数据变化过程。
通过以上各种数据可视化工具,用户可以根据不同数据类型和分析需求,选择合适的图表形式,直观地展示数据的特征和规律,帮助用户快速理解数据并进行有效决策。FineBI、FineReport和FineVis作为专业的数据可视化工具,提供了丰富的图表类型和定制选项,用户可以根据需要创建各种数据可视化图表,满足不同的数据分析需求。
相关问答FAQs:
FAQ 1: 如何选择合适的可视化图表类型来展示不同的数据?
选择合适的可视化图表类型是数据展示的关键步骤。根据数据的性质和你希望传达的信息,图表类型的选择会有很大不同。例如:
-
数据类型:如果你要展示类别数据,如产品分类或用户反馈的种类,柱状图和饼图可能是不错的选择。柱状图可以帮助比较不同类别的数量,而饼图则适合展示各部分在总体中的占比。
-
数据趋势:对于展示数据随时间的变化,折线图或面积图通常比较适合。折线图能清晰地显示出数据的上升或下降趋势,而面积图可以提供额外的视觉效果,显示数据的累计量。
-
数据分布:要展示数据分布情况时,散点图或箱线图是有效的选择。散点图能够显示数据点的分布情况以及可能的相关性,而箱线图则适合展示数据的集中趋势和离散程度。
-
数据比较:当需要比较多组数据时,堆积柱状图或条形图会显得很有用。堆积柱状图能够展示各组数据的总体及其组成部分,而条形图则适合用来对比不同组别的数据。
-
数据关系:要展示不同数据之间的关系,如相关性或依赖性,气泡图或热图是很好的选择。气泡图可以展示数据点之间的相对关系和大小,而热图则通过颜色的变化来表示数据的密度或强度。
根据数据的特点选择合适的图表类型,可以更有效地传达信息,使观众更容易理解数据的含义和趋势。
FAQ 2: 使用哪些工具可以创建高质量的数据可视化图表?
创建高质量的数据可视化图表可以通过各种工具来实现,以下是一些受欢迎的选择:
-
Microsoft Excel:Excel是最常用的工具之一,适合基本的数据可视化需求。它提供了多种图表类型,如柱状图、折线图、饼图等,并且支持数据的基本分析功能。对于快速生成图表和处理小规模数据,Excel是一个可靠的选择。
-
Tableau:Tableau是一款功能强大的数据可视化工具,适合需要处理大量数据和复杂分析的情况。它支持拖放操作,能够轻松创建交互式的图表和仪表板,并提供多种数据连接选项,方便整合不同来源的数据。
-
Power BI:由微软提供的Power BI是另一个强大的数据可视化工具。它不仅支持多种图表类型,还能够与其他Microsoft产品无缝集成。Power BI适合于企业环境,能够处理大量数据并提供详细的报告功能。
-
Google Data Studio:这是一个免费的在线工具,适合需要与Google产品(如Google Analytics)进行集成的用户。Google Data Studio支持创建互动仪表板和报表,易于共享和协作。
-
D3.js:如果你有编程背景,并且需要创建高度定制化的图表,D3.js是一个值得考虑的库。它提供了丰富的功能,可以实现复杂的数据可视化需求,但需要一定的编程技能。
每个工具都有其特点和优势,选择适合的工具可以帮助你更高效地创建精美的数据可视化图表。
FAQ 3: 如何确保数据可视化图表的准确性和有效性?
确保数据可视化图表的准确性和有效性是至关重要的,以下几个方面可以帮助你达成这一目标:
-
数据验证:在创建图表之前,确保数据的准确性和完整性是首要步骤。检查数据源是否可靠,验证数据的来源和计算方式,以避免错误和偏差。
-
图表设计:设计图表时要避免使用可能导致误解的元素。例如,选择合适的图表类型、合理的坐标轴刻度和清晰的标签,可以帮助观众准确解读数据。避免使用过于复杂的图表,简洁明了的设计更容易传达信息。
-
数据标准化:在处理数据时,确保数据的一致性和标准化。比如,在同一图表中使用统一的单位和格式,这有助于避免误导和混淆。
-
交互性:提供交互式功能,如过滤器和下拉菜单,可以让用户根据需求查看不同的数据视图。这不仅增加了图表的灵活性,还能帮助用户更深入地分析数据。
-
测试和反馈:在发布图表之前,进行测试和收集反馈是非常重要的。让不同背景的用户查看图表,并收集他们的意见,可以帮助你发现潜在的问题并进行改进。
通过关注这些方面,可以确保你的数据可视化图表既准确又有效,从而更好地服务于数据分析和决策过程。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。